dc.description.abstractAir is the most important substance after water in providing life on the surface of this earth. In addition to providing oxygen, air also functions as a means of conveying sounds and sounds, cooling hot objects, and can be a medium for the spread of disease in living things. Air in nature has never been found clean without pollutants every day so that it can cause damage to the respiratory tract in humans or animals and plants. Ambient air quality standard is a measure of the limits or levels of substances, energy and / or components that exist or which should be and / or pollutants which are tolerated in the ambient air. In this case the content of NO2 in ambient air were analyzed using the Griess Saltzman method by spectrophotometry at a wavelength of 550 nm. The results of analysis obtained from NO2 parameters are 7,68 μg/Nm3. Where the requirements according to the Government Regulation of the Republic of Indonesia number 41 of 1999 concerning air pollution control are declared safe and meet the requirements for human health and the environment.en_US
